dc.description.abstractThe boundary layer flow over a horizontal plate with power law variations in the freestream velocity and wall temperature of the form Ue ∼ xn and Tw − T∞ ∼ xm and with viscous dissipation, is studied. The boundary layer equations are transformed to a dimensionless system of equations using a non–similarity variable (x) and a pseudo-similarity variable (x; y). The effects of the various parameters of the flow on velocity and temperature distribution in the boundary layer, on the local skin friction and local heat transfer coefficients and on the non–similar terms, are investigated.en_US
